Transaction 2d61b381855848cfe178a440a395247b54ff43ee67d6aed47c217531a5e5b775
1 Input
1 Output
-
2d61b381855848cfe178a440a395247b54ff43ee67d6aed47c217531a5e5b775:0
- value
- 285587
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0e53d8bbd29d232632d305ad33ab8166cf3f42c8 OP_EQUAL
- address
- 32zmpzdNjJpizYrXL9MebqE7evLXL1Y6EX